Bamboo Splitting Machine Market Insights

Global Bamboo Splitting Machine market was valued at USD 120 million in 2025 and is projected to reach USD 250 million by 2034, at a CAGR of 8.3% during the forecast period. A bamboo splitting machine is a specialized piece of equipment designed to split bamboo poles into smaller, uniform sections or strips. The machine typically consists of a feed mechanism to hold the bamboo in place, a splitting mechanism such as blades or rollers that apply force to split the bamboo, and a discharge area where the split bamboo pieces come out. This process is essential for further processing and utilization of bamboo in construction, furniture making, handicrafts, and other applications. The machine enhances efficiency, precision, and safety, making it indispensable for bamboo‑using industries.

MARKET DRIVERS

Growing Demand for Sustainable Construction Materials

Environmental regulations and carbon‑neutral commitments have accelerated the adoption of bamboo as an alternative to timber and steel in construction. Globally, the sustainable construction sector is expanding at an average annual rate of over 7%, driven by stricter building codes and rising consumer awareness of ecological footprints. As architects and engineers increasingly specify bamboo for structural elements, flooring, and façade panels, the need for efficient, high‑precision splitting equipment has intensified. Manufacturers report that projects in Southeast Asia and Latin America have doubled the volume of bamboo components ordered since 2021, compelling suppliers to scale up production capacity. This surge directly fuels demand for advanced splitting machines capable of handling larger diameters while maintaining uniformity, thereby shortening lead times and reducing material waste.

Rapid Expansion of Bamboo‑Based Furniture and Handicraft Industries

The global bamboo furniture market is projected to surpass US$ 30 billion by 2028, reflecting a compound annual growth of approximately 9% driven by urbanization, rising disposable incomes, and a shift toward eco‑friendly décor. Handicraft producers in India, Vietnam, and Kenya have reported a 45% increase in export orders for split‑bamboo products such as baskets, blinds, and decorative panels over the past three years. These trends demand high‑throughput splitting machines that can produce consistent strip widths for both mass‑production lines and small‑batch artisanal workshops. Moreover, the integration of CNC‑controlled blade systems has enabled manufacturers to achieve tighter tolerances, meeting the aesthetic and structural requirements of premium furniture brands. The convergence of fashion‑forward design and sustainability is thus a powerful catalyst for machine sales.

Technological Advancements in Automation and IoT Integration

Industry 4.0 initiatives are reshaping traditional woodworking equipment, and bamboo splitting machines are no exception. Sensors that monitor blade wear, feed pressure, and split quality feed data to cloud‑based analytics platforms, enabling predictive maintenance and real‑time process optimization. According to recent field trials, factories that integrated IoT‑enabled splitters experienced a 20% reduction in downtime and a 15% improvement in material utilization. Additionally, the adoption of robotic loading and unloading systems has minimized manual handling, enhancing worker safety and allowing continuous 24‑hour operation. Such automation reduces labor costs a critical consideration in regions where manufacturing wages are rising while delivering the scalability required to serve large‑scale infrastructure projects.

MARKET CHALLENGES

High Capital Expenditure for Advanced Splitting Systems

While modern bamboo splitting machines offer superior efficiency, their upfront cost remains a barrier for small‑ and medium‑sized enterprises. A fully automated, IoT‑integrated splitter can exceed US$ 150,000, a price point that exceeds the typical equipment budget of many rural manufacturers in Africa and South‑East Asia. Financing options are limited, and the long payback period often extending beyond three years discourages investment, especially in markets where bamboo prices fluctuate seasonally. Consequently, a segment of the market continues to rely on manual or semi‑mechanical splitters, which hampers overall productivity improvements and slows adoption of best‑practice standards.

Other Challenges

Regulatory Hurdles

Many jurisdictions are tightening standards for building materials to ensure fire safety and structural integrity. Certification processes for bamboo components require rigorous testing, and manufacturers must demonstrate that split pieces meet specific dimensional tolerances and moisture content criteria. Compliance expenses add to the overall cost structure, and delayed approvals can interrupt supply chains, particularly for large‑scale public infrastructure projects.

Supply Chain Constraints

The raw bamboo supply chain is vulnerable to climatic variability. Droughts and monsoon shifts have led to a 12% reduction in harvestable culms in major producing regions during the past two years. This contraction increases raw material prices and creates bottlenecks for machine operators who depend on steady feedstock. Limited storage capacity for harvested bamboo also forces producers to time their splitting operations around seasonal availability, reducing equipment utilization rates.

MARKET RESTRAINTS

Technical Complications and Shortage of Skilled Professionals to Deter Market Growth

Precision splitting of bamboo requires careful calibration of blade geometry, feed speed, and moisture control. Variations in culm diameter and internal fiber density can cause blade deflection, leading to uneven strips and increased waste. Manufacturers must invest in adaptive control algorithms that adjust parameters in real time technology that is still emerging and costly to implement. Moreover, operating and maintaining these sophisticated machines demand technicians with specialized knowledge of both mechanical engineering and material science. Current vocational programs in many bamboo‑rich regions lack curricula that cover such interdisciplinary skills, resulting in a talent gap that slows technology diffusion.

Fragmented Market Structure Limits Economies of Scale

The bamboo processing industry is highly fragmented, with thousands of micro‑enterprises operating independently. This dispersion makes it difficult for equipment manufacturers to achieve the economies of scale needed to lower unit costs. Unlike the steel or plastic sectors, where a few large players dominate, bamboo processors often negotiate purchase agreements on a case‑by‑case basis, preventing bulk pricing discounts for machinery. As a result, the overall market price for high‑end splitters remains elevated, constraining broader adoption across the value chain.

MARKET OPPORTUNITIES

Surge in Strategic Initiatives by Key Players to Provide Profitable Opportunities for Future Growth

Leading manufacturers are launching modular splitter platforms that can be retrofitted with AI‑driven quality inspection modules. These initiatives aim to offer scalable solutions for both large factories and emerging micro‑enterprises, lowering entry barriers while opening recurring revenue streams through software licensing. Partnerships with renewable energy providers are also emerging, allowing plants to power splitters with solar or bio‑energy, thereby reducing operating costs and aligning with green certifications demanded by international buyers.

Expansion into New Geographic Markets Driven by Infrastructure Investment

Governments across Africa and the Middle East have announced multi‑billion‑dollar infrastructure programs that prioritize locally sourced, low‑carbon materials. Incentive schemes, such as tax credits for using bamboo in public projects, are encouraging contractors to source split bamboo components, thereby creating a reliable demand pipeline for splitting machines. Early entrants that establish local service centers and training facilities stand to capture significant market share as these regions transition from imported timber to domestically produced bamboo.

Development of Value‑Added Bamboo Products Requiring Specialized Splitting Capabilities

Innovation in bamboo composites and engineered panels is unlocking high‑value applications in automotive interiors and aerospace interiors, where dimensional precision is paramount. These sectors require split bamboo strips with tolerance ranges of ±0.2 mm, a specification that only advanced multi‑blade, computer‑controlled splitters can meet. The projected growth of the engineered bamboo market expected to exceed US$ 5 billion by 2030 presents a lucrative niche for manufacturers willing to invest in R&D and custom machine configurations, fostering a cycle of product differentiation and premium pricing.
